A Different Kind of Debate


Here we have a clip from the Presidential Debate between Cain and Gingrich and it is clearly not the kind of debate we are used to seeing in the election/campaign process. The two are sitting together at a table and, far from debating, are helping each other along as if they are running together. This "Lincoln-Douglas" style debate allows both candidates to speak for longer and make each other look good so both end up leaving with a positive a performance as possible, rather than one trying to make the other look like a fool.
